    <p>The most simple way to solve this is to use an OS which solves that for you under the hood, like Linux. Give it enough RAM to hold 10% of the objects in RAM and it will try to keep as many of them in the cache as possible reducing the load time to 0. The recent <em>server</em> versions of Windows might work, too (some of them didn't for me, that's why I'm mentioning this).</p> <p>If this is a no go, try this algorithm:</p> <ul> <li><p>Create a very big file on the harddisk. It is very important that you write this in one go so the OS will allocate a continuous space on disk.</p></li> <li><p>Write all your objects into that file. Make sure that each object is the same size (or give each the same space in the file and note the length in the first few bytes of of each chunk). Use an empty harddisk or a disk which has just been defragmented.</p></li> <li><p>In a data structure, keep the offsets of each data chunk and how often it is accessed. When it is accessed very often, swap its position in the file with a chunk that is closer to the start of the file and which has a lesser access count.</p></li> <li><p>[EDIT] Access this file with the memory-mapped API of your OS to allow the OS to effectively cache the most used parts to get best performance until you can optimize the file layout next time.</p></li> </ul> <p>Over time, heavily accessed chunks will bubble to the top. Note that you can collect the access patterns over some time, analyze them and do the reorder over night when there is little load on your machine. Or you can do the reorder on a completely different machine and swap the file (and the offset table) when that's done.</p> <p>That said, you should really rely on a modern OS where a lot of clever people have thought long and hard to solve these issues for you.</p>
